Scientific name: CosmosbipinnatusCav alias: Qiuying, Compositae: Compositae, Autumn British Persian chrysanthemum is an annual herb, plant height 30-120cm, thin stem erect, more branched, smooth stem or with puberulent hairs. Leaves opposite, ca. LOcm, bipinnatifid, lobes narrowly linear, entire toothless. Heads inserted on slender pedicels, terminal or axillary, flowering stems 5-8cm. The total coating film is 2 layers, and the inner edge is membranous. There are 8 petals with white, pink and crimson petals. The tubular flowers occupy the Shenyang part of the disk and are all yellow. Achenes have rafters, seed life 3-4 years, dry grain weight 69. Flowering in summer and autumn.

Growth habits of Persian chrysanthemum:

Persian chrysanthemum native to Mexico and other parts of South America, light-loving plants, light, tolerance to poor soil, avoid fertilizer, soil is too fertile, avoid heat, avoid stagnant water, do not adapt to high temperature in summer, not resistant to cold. Loose, fertile and well-drained loam is needed.

How to grow Persian chrysanthemum:

Persian chrysanthemum is a kind of tenacious floret, drought-resistant and sun-resistant, very good species, and high germination rate, fast growth. More choice of sowing and reproduction, can also be planted, sowing can be broadcast in the open field in early spring. After 4 true leaves of the seedling, the heart can be removed and transplanted. It was planted at the beginning of June, and the distance from the plant to 50cm was about. The spring sower will not blossom until autumn. It can also be inserted with twigs in early summer.

Sowing time of Persian chrysanthemum

When summer flowering is needed, the seeds should be sown from February to March in early spring, preferably under the condition that the temperature and humidity can be controlled. If you plan to sow seeds in the open air, you should sow in the middle of April when the temperature is suitable. When the temperature is suitable, seedlings can emerge in about a week.

The sowing medium should be loose and rich in organic matter, and a certain amount of mature organic fertilizer should be applied before sowing. When sowing, mix the seeds with a certain amount of sand and spread them evenly on the seedling bed, then cover the soil for about one centimeter. After sowing, the soil moisture should be maintained and the temperature should be controlled at about 18 ℃.

Management of Persian Chrysanthemum at Seedling stage

When the seedlings grow 4 to 5 true leaves, they can be transplanted into a nutrition bowl and removed from the heart. There is no need to apply topdressing during the seedling growth period, so as not to cause excessive growth of branches and leaves and affect flowering.

Management of growing period of Persian chrysanthemum

The plant type of Persian chrysanthemum is relatively tall, the stem is thin and weak, the flowers are large and beautiful, and they will lodge in the wind or other bad weather, affecting the ornamental value. Therefore, the whole growth process of Persian chrysanthemum needs to pick the heart many times and reduce watering, which can not only promote branching, but also dwarf the plant and avoid lodging in the growth process.
